Fan-out backpressure for the Quillet notifier: when the queue depth crosses the soft limit, the dispatcher sheds low-priority pushes and batches the rest at 500ms intervals. Reviewer should confirm the shed counter is exported and that retries respect the jitter window. Once merged, the release artifact gets re-signed by the pipeline, which expects the deploy key shown below.

deploy key for bawep-yawif: bky6_GQhaSt

Handover — spare hardware store, Basement B2, Kellwick House. Shelving relabelled Tuesday; monitors left wall, cables in bins 4–7. Loan log lives on the clipboard by the door — keep it updated. Door lock was rekeyed after the Marbeck audit. Use the pass below to get in.

turnstile pass: bdg-JVSWH-52711

Subject: Key rotation for InvoiceForge renderer

Welcome, new folks. Every quarter we rotate the credential the Pellworth PDF invoice renderer uses to call our internal asset service, Vaultline. The old key stops working Friday at noon. Update your local .env and the staging config before then, and verify a test invoice renders with the new embedded fonts. For convenience, the freshly issued key is included here.

app token of bagef-bageg = kto11_vuwA0uhrEMg